United States Polaris Expedition (1871–1873)
The United States Polaris Expedition (1871–1873) was an American Arctic exploration mission led by Charles Francis Hall that sought to reach the North Pole but became infamous for Hall’s mysterious death and the crew’s subsequent struggle for survival on drifting ice floes.
